When faced with a malfunctioning locking system, the following step-by-step guide can assist homeowners or handypersons carry out repairs.
1. Preliminary Assessment
Start by examining the extent of the issue. Check if the window is properly lined up and observe how the locking system responds when operated.
2. Tools Required
Before starting the repair, collect the necessary tools:
Screwdriver (Phillips and flathead)Lubricant (silicone spray or graphite)Replacement parts (if needed)PliersAllen wrench3. Take Apart the Locking MechanismEliminate the Handle: Unscrew the manage to access the locking system.Take off the Cover Plate: Depending on the design, you might need to remove a cover plate to reach the locking elements.4. Inspect for Damage
Carefully take a look at the lock cylinder, equipments, and other components for any indications of wear, damage, or misalignment.
5. Tidy and LubricateEliminate Debris: Use compressed air or a soft cloth to clean out dirt or debris from the system.Lube: Apply an appropriate lubricant to the moving parts. Prevent utilizing oil-based lubricants as they may draw in more dirt.6. Replace Damaged Parts
If any parts are harmed or broken, replace them with compatible parts. Ensure you have the appropriate requirements.
7. Reassemble and Test
Reassemble the locking system by reversing the disassembly steps. After reassembly, test the locking system several times to guarantee it operates properly.
8. Inspect Alignment
If the window is still not locking properly, look for positioning issues. Adjust the hinges or the frame as essential.

How do I understand if my window locking system needs repair?
Indications consist of trouble locking or opening, the handle spinning without engaging the lock, and gaps when the window is closed.
2. Can I repair the locking system myself?
Yes, if you are comfortable utilizing tools and following directions. Nevertheless, for complex repairs or replacement, it might be best to speak with a professional.
3. What should I do if I lose the key to my window lock?
Consider calling a locksmith professional for crucial replacement or using a lock-picking approach if you're familiar with that process. Changing the lock cylinder might also be essential.
4. How frequently should I perform upkeep?
It's suggested to carry out upkeep at least twice a year, ideally throughout spring and fall.
5. What kind of lubricant is best for a locking mechanism?
Silicone-based or graphite lubricants are perfect as they withstand dirt build-up and offer lasting lubrication.
